Counselor - IP
Position Summary :
This position of Counselor / Clinical Case Manager will provide supportive counseling and education to help support patients and families who are experiencing emotional, financial, and psycho-social concerns following spinal cord, acquired brain injury, and other neurological disorders. Clinical Care Managers are : patient advocates, team leaders / liaisons, clinical team members, counselors, liaisons with insurance and other funding resources, and discharge planners.

Position Requirements :
- Licensure / Certification / Registrations : None.
- Education : Master's Degree from an accredited college or university in Social Work, Licensed Professional Counselor, Rehabilitation Counseling or in a related field. Specialized training in rehabilitation or equivalent experience working with people who are spinal cord injured and acquired brain injury.
- Experience : 3–5 years of experience in a rehabilitation or hospital setting with a neurologic population preferred.
- Skills & Abilities : Ability to successfully handle multiple priorities and schedule accordingly while meeting established deadlines. Must be able to successfully and effectively communicate with a variety of personnel. Problem solve complex medical , legal, and discharge issues. Effectively manage conflict between family members. Flexible in changing discharge planning due to insurance denials. Able to maintain a high degree of accuracy, dependability, and strong attention to detail both mechanically and technically. Ability to maintain confidentiality in all aspects of the position. Computer skills — Epic, Microsoft Office.
Essential Functions :
Assist and educate patients / families in accessing financial resources.Individual and family counselingIdentifies community resources to help patients discharge from rehabilitation and resume community living.Recognize patient and family goals and provides pertinent education through individual and group counseling.Communicate with hospital personnel both verbally and in writing about significant psychosocial factors that may affect the patient's progress.Writes reports and letters and maintains pertinent records of services provided.Participate in departmental and interdepartmental planning to improve medical / rehabilitative services.Perform in accordance with hospital and departmental policy and procedures.Provide services to adolescent, adult and geriatric patients and adapt the service as needed.Cultural awareness to meet all patient’s needs.This job description is not intended to be an exhaustive list of all duties.
